Brand Design for Zuul

Zuul is a start-up Ghost Kitchen based in Soho with an ambition to revolutionize the way people connect with food and restaurants.  Zuul approached Joan Creative to build their brand identity from scratch. The name - inspired by the ghost in Ghostbusters that hung out in Sigourney Weaver’s fridge - was a great jumping point to design a humorous, energetic, clever, and ultimately human identity. 

Working as design director for the project, I created a cohesive identity package with a new logo design, iconography, print, digital, and apparel.
